Understanding Roof Vent Functionality

Roof vents, whether they are ridge vents running along the peak of your roof, box vents strategically placed on the roof’s slope, or turbine vents that spin with the wind, all share a common purpose: to facilitate the flow of air through your attic space. This airflow is essential for several reasons:

  • **Temperature Regulation:** In Monrovia’s sunny climate, attics can become incredibly hot. Proper ventilation allows this heat to escape, preventing it from transferring into your living spaces and reducing reliance on air conditioning. Conversely, in cooler months, it helps prevent the buildup of condensation.
  • **Moisture Control:** Humidity generated within the home, combined with moisture from rain or even melting snow, can accumulate in the attic. Without adequate ventilation, this moisture can condense on insulation and wooden structures, creating a breeding ground for mold, mildew, and wood rot.
  • **Extending Roof Lifespan:** Excessive heat can degrade roofing materials like asphalt shingles over time, shortening their lifespan. Proper ventilation helps keep the roof deck cooler, reducing this stress and contributing to a more durable roof.

Common Roof Vent Issues Requiring Repair

Like any part of your home exposed to the elements, roof vents can suffer wear and tear. Identifying these issues early is key to preventing more significant damage. Common problems that necessitate roof vent repair in Monrovia include:

  • **Cracks and Deterioration:** Exposure to sunlight and fluctuating temperatures can cause plastic or metal vents to crack or become brittle and deteriorate over time.
  • **Obstructions:** Debris, leaves, or even nesting animals can block vent openings, hindering airflow.
  • **Loose or Damaged Fasteners:** Wind, especially during storm activity common in Southern California, can loosen or dislodge the fasteners holding vents in place, leading to leaks.
  • **Rust and Corrosion:** Metal vents, particularly in coastal proximity or areas with higher humidity, can succumb to rust and corrosion, compromising their function and appearance.
  • **Improper Installation:** Vents that were not installed correctly in the first place are more prone to failure.

The Inspection Process

A qualified roofer will begin by conducting a comprehensive visual inspection of all your roof vents. This often includes climbing onto the roof to meticulously examine each vent, as well as inspecting the interior of the attic for signs of moisture damage or poor ventilation. They will look for the common issues mentioned above, paying close attention to the seal around the vents where they meet the roofing material, as this is a common entry point for water.

Repair and Replacement Methods

The specific repair method will depend on the nature of the problem. For minor cracks, professionals might use specialized sealants or patches designed for roofing applications. If fasteners are loose, they will be tightened, and any compromised areas around the vent will be properly sealed to prevent leaks. In cases where a vent is severely damaged, rusted, or no longer functional, replacement will be recommended. Replacement involves carefully removing the old vent, preparing the opening, and installing a new vent with appropriate flashing and sealing to ensure a watertight and efficient installation.

Materials Commonly Used

Roofing contractors in Monrovia typically use high-quality materials designed to withstand the local climate. These can include:

  • **Durable Plastics:** UV-resistant plastics are common for many types of vents, offering longevity.
  • **Galvanized Steel or Aluminum:** For metal vents, these materials provide good corrosion resistance.
  • **Roofing Sealants and Flashing:** Specialized sealants and metal flashing are crucial for creating a watertight seal between the vent and your roof, preventing water intrusion.

How often should my roof vents be inspected in Monrovia?

It is generally recommended to have your roof vents inspected at least once a year, ideally in the spring or fall. An annual inspection allows professionals to identify any potential issues before they become severe, especially after experiencing fluctuating weather. Homeowners should also conduct visual checks after significant weather events, such as strong winds or heavy rainfall, to spot any immediate signs of damage.
